Why Animas?
School has always had its ups and downs for me. For the entire year of eighth grade, I was hesitant about which high school I would attend. Both DHS and AHS have their pros and cons. I decided to go to Animas because its learning style fits the way I learn and take in information. I can apply the knowledge that I gain throughout our units and utilize it in mini-exhibitions and exhibitions. Having a basic knowledge of what I am presenting or even an exceeding knowledge is what I expect from AHS. Although DHS had more electives that I would like to try and possibly do when I graduate high school, I felt that Animals would have a better learning environment. When learning I really wanted to be able to have a genuine connection with the teachers so I’d enjoy and have an interest in what they were teaching. I felt that with smaller cohorts in classes it would be more likely to create that connection as a result there would be an environment where learning is enjoyable. Having friends in school is very important to me, but at DHS I think I would have been very focused on befriending everyone, to the point where I would be unable to advocate for myself education-wise.
At Animas, I already knew a lot of students who were going to attend here, so I figured I wouldn’t worry about being social as much as applying myself. For the next four years at AHS, I have the goal of discovering what I’d like to do out of high school after I graduate, as well as getting to know myself better. I want to know myself better so I can feel confident in the things I like and what I can improve on. If I don't know my identity, surely I won't know what I would want to do for a job after highschool and college. After high school, I hope to have discovered myself, the things I enjoy in life, things I want to try, and pursue something that I’m passionate about. Having my education is very important for various reasons. Having a good education will allow me to try new things and other activities that I am already fond of. Before graduating highschool, learning basic abilities that will help me in the daily tasks that adults must do is very important to me because as a student I can ask others for help and really improve myself, so being at Animas will help me learn so I can be prepared as an adult.. I came to Animas High School and I’m here to stay.
